We are looking to appoint a Learning Partners/Teaching Assistant to join our dedicated and friendly team. The main purpose of the Learning Partner is to support teaching and learning within classes. The role requires enthusiasm, hard work and a passion for supporting high quality learning to maximise a pupil's potential.
The TrustWe are passionate that every child deserves the very best education. As a partnership we will: improve outcomes, opportunities and life chances for children and young people, offer more / wider support for their families and share and develop staff expertise.
The successful applicant should have a passion for working with pupils who have special educational needs and disabilities, with some experience working with children and in supporting teaching and learning. You may be working in a similar role such as a healthcare assistant, if you are passionate, caring, and have good communication skills we can offer all the training and support you need to become a Learning Partner/Teaching Assistant with us.
BenefitsBy joining our team, we offer you generous annual leave allowance, generous pension scheme (LGPS), Employee Assistance Program & Counselling, Occupational Health Service, Continuing Professional Development and Staff Get Staff Referral Scheme. Applications for flexible working or job share will be considered on an individual basis.
